Output 743797bd2786886e0fca61cf144a7978330f55f2509508540000e8e30a142f23:0

value
13383100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f23a3ef291fb9490f82679bb4b0926cf3f97a35 OP_EQUALVERIFY OP_CHECKSIG
address
1E3rKmYLQ8p2FVwsQSHXz9or8n7BEtDa2e
transaction
743797bd2786886e0fca61cf144a7978330f55f2509508540000e8e30a142f23
spent
true